What Does Siddiqa Mean?
Siddiqa means "Truthful, righteous".
Different Meanings of Siddiqa (2)
- 1Truthful
- 2Righteous
Siddiqa is a girl name of Arabic origin, frequently chosen in Islamic communities. It carries the meaning "Truthful, righteous". Siddiqa has 2 syllables and is a meaningful choice for parents drawn to its sound and significance.
Etymology and Historical Origins
The name Siddiqa derives from Arabic naming tradition, where it conveys the sense of "Truthful, righteous".
